Risk Management - The management has identified macroeconomic risks that could impact future performance, including fluctuations in metal prices[4]. - The company is subject to special disclosure requirements due to its engagement in solid mineral resources industry[54]. - The company is facing risks from global economic uncertainties and structural issues within the non-ferrous metal industry[102]. - The company has established a futures management approach to control risks associated with market price fluctuations and operational processes[87]. - The company’s hedging strategy includes major products such as tin, copper, zinc, gold, and silver, effectively managing price increase risks[87]. Social Responsibility and Environmental Impact - In 2017, the company invested a total of 24.17 million yuan in poverty alleviation efforts, helping 1,593 registered poor households to escape poverty[168]. - The company allocated 5 million yuan specifically for poverty alleviation in the Honghe Prefecture, while its subsidiary donated 19.17 million yuan for public welfare and new rural construction[168]. - The company has implemented measures to ensure compliance with pollution discharge standards, with no instances of exceeding limits reported[175]. - The company invested CNY 50.92 million in pollution source management and CNY 171.18 million in the operation of pollution control facilities, ensuring all pollution facilities operated effectively throughout the year[176]. - The company actively seeks social resources for poverty alleviation, partnering with Anxin Securities to support educational initiatives[169].
